Trade Buyer Seeking Children's Services Provider , UK Wide
Original reference BW000639 · Children's Services & Complex Needs
Requirement as originally published
Operating group seeking a complementary acquisition that can be integrated without disruption. Target focus: Children’s Services & Complex Needs. Preference for children’s services & complex needs with robust processes, low incident history and strong documentation. Would consider deferred consideration where retention and service KPIs are measurable. Would consider phased integration to avoid disruption to clients, learners or patients. UK buyer seeking UK based targets. Target turnover band £5m to £10m.
